A local power company is considering increasing its generating capacity to meet expected demand over the next 5 years. Currently, the company has a generating capacity of 600 MW. As per the demand forecast, the minimum generating capacities required over the next 5 years are as follows: Year 1 2 3 4 5 670 760 890 1020 1180 Minimum capacity (MW) The company can increase its transmission capacity by purchasing five different types of generators: 20, 50, 80, 100, and 120 MW. The costs of acquiring, installing, and operating each of the five types of generators are summarized below: Acquiring and Generator Type (MW) Installation Cost/Unit" Operating Cost/Unit/Year 20 5.0 2.0 50 10.0 4.0 80 13.0 6.0 100 17.0 8.0 120 22.0 10.0 "In million dollars. Any number of generators (of any type) can be added in any year. However, once a generator is added, it must be operated in the future years as required. Formulate a mathematical programming model to determine the least cost expansion plan, for 5 years, while fulfilling all yearly demand
